3. 贪心算法 如任务调度问题,总是选择当前最优任务执行。
确保你的 PATH 环境变量包含 $GOPATH/bin 或 $GOBIN,以便可以直接运行安装的可执行文件。
它支持短选项(单字符)和选项参数。
constexpr 构造函数和对象 你也可以定义 constexpr 构造函数,创建编译期常量对象。
立即学习“go语言免费学习笔记(深入)”; package main <p>import "fmt"</p><p>// 发起人:要保存状态的对象 type Editor struct { Content string CursorX int CursorY int }</p><p>// 创建备忘录(保存当前状态) func (e <em>Editor) Save() </em>Memento { return &Memento{ Content: e.Content, CursorX: e.CursorX, CursorY: e.CursorY, } }</p><p>// 从备忘录恢复状态 func (e <em>Editor) Restore(m </em>Memento) { e.Content = m.Content e.CursorX = m.CursorX e.CursorY = m.CursorY }</p><p>// 备忘录:保存状态,对外不可变 type Memento struct { Content string CursorX int CursorY int }</p><p>// 管理者:管理多个备忘录(如历史记录) type History struct { states []*Memento }</p><p>func (h <em>History) Push(m </em>Memento) { h.states = append(h.states, m) }</p><p>func (h <em>History) Pop() </em>Memento { if len(h.states) == 0 { return nil } index := len(h.states) - 1 m := h.states[index] h.states = h.states[:index] return m }</p>使用方式:保存与恢复 以下是如何使用上述结构进行状态恢复的示例。
1. 安装davecheney/gpio库 在使用之前,首先需要将该库安装到您的Go项目中。
其他Expanding聚合: 这种方法不仅适用于mean(),也适用于expanding().sum()、expanding().min()、expanding().max()、expanding().count()等所有expanding()支持的聚合函数。
它与C++的RAII(Resource Acquisition Is Initialization)机制配合得很好,确保即使在异常发生时,已分配的资源也能被正确释放。
与左值引用(&)不同,右值引用可以修改所绑定的对象,并通常用于“窃取”资源。
性能考量: range是Go语言中遍历切片、数组等集合的惯用且高效的方式。
注意必须加WHERE条件,避免误改全部数据: $sql = "UPDATE users SET email='zhangsan_new@example.com' WHERE name='张三'";<br>if (mysqli_query($conn, $sql)) {<br> echo "记录更新成功";<br>} else {<br> echo "更新失败:" . mysqli_error($conn);<br>} 同样推荐使用预处理语句绑定参数,提高安全性。
在 PHP 中,对多维数组进行排序是一个常见的需求。
例如定义一个 person 元素包含姓名和年龄: <xs:element name="person"> <xs:complexType> <xs:sequence> <xs:element name="name" type="xs:string"/> <xs:element name="age" type="xs:integer"/> </xs:sequence> </xs:complexType> </xs:element> 其中 xs:sequence 表示子元素必须按定义顺序出现。
在go语言中,当我们使用make(chan int)创建一个通道时,它默认是双向的,既可以发送数据,也可以接收数据。
关键是把路由配置从静态变为可变,并确保变更过程线程安全。
这里我们会遍历$_FILES数组,对每个文件进行处理。
在C++中,unique_ptr 是一种智能指针,用于独占式管理动态分配的对象。
在设计时需要考虑这种潜在的并发影响。
安全性: 在模型层构建SQL查询时,务必使用参数绑定或框架提供的安全查询方法(如CodeIgniter的where_in()或查询构造器),避免直接拼接用户输入,以防止SQL注入攻击。
注意事项 确保你的 Python 环境已正确安装,并且已安装 PIL (Pillow) 模块,否则可能会出现与图像处理相关的警告。
本文链接:http://www.jnmotorsbikes.com/33921_808904.html